Geography
Nestled on the eastern coast of Bruny Island, Adventure Bay is framed by rolling hills, lush forests, and pristine beaches. The crystal-clear waters of Adventure Bay provide the perfect setting for swimming, snorkeling, and kayaking. The town is also surrounded by rugged cliffs and dramatic rock formations, creating a breathtaking backdrop for outdoor adventures.

Notable Features
One of the most famous features of Adventure Bay is the historic Cook's Cottage, a replica of the childhood home of Captain James Cook. Visitors can learn about the explorer's voyages and the history of the area through interactive displays and guided tours. Other notable attractions include the Bruny Island Neck Lookout, which offers panoramic views of Adventure Bay and the surrounding coastline, and the South Bruny National Park, home to diverse wildlife and stunning hiking trails.
Adventure Bay is also a popular destination for wildlife enthusiasts, as the area is home to a variety of native animals, including wallabies, echidnas, and a wide array of bird species. Whale watching tours are also available during the migration season, providing a unique opportunity to see these majestic creatures up close.
